    (From the authors' summary.) The authors have considered semidiscrete and single step fully discrete approximation to the solutions of the time dependent incompressible elasticity equations. Two methods of dealing with the constraint are analysed: (a) a formulation involving a 'discrete' form of incompressibility condition and (b) a penalty formulation. \(H^ 1\)- and \(L^ 2\)-error estimates are obtained.
